use std::collections::HashMap;
use crossterm::cursor::SetCursorStyle;
use crossterm::execute;
use crossterm::style::Print;
use crate::Result;
use crate::app::input::text_area_vim::TextAreaVimState;
use crate::core::node::{NodeId, NodeKind, NodeTree};
use crate::style::{CaretShape, Color};
use crate::widgets::TextAreaVimMode;
pub(crate) struct TerminalManager {
pub last_cursor_color: Option<(u8, u8, u8)>,
pub osc12_supported: bool,
}
impl Default for TerminalManager {
fn default() -> Self {
Self {
last_cursor_color: None,
osc12_supported: supports_osc12_cursor_color(),
}
}
}
impl TerminalManager {
pub fn update_cursor<B: std::io::Write>(
&mut self,
backend: &mut B,
tree: &NodeTree,
focused: Option<NodeId>,
text_area_vim_state: &HashMap<NodeId, TextAreaVimState>,
) -> Result<()> {
let mut target_style = SetCursorStyle::DefaultUserShape;
let mut desired_cursor_color: Option<(u8, u8, u8)> = None;
if let Some(id) = focused
&& tree.is_valid(id)
{
let node = tree.node(id);
let theme = node.active_theme();
let caret = match &node.kind {
NodeKind::TextArea(node) => {
if node.read_only {
None
} else {
let caret_shape = node.caret_shape.unwrap_or(theme.caret.shape);
if self.osc12_supported {
desired_cursor_color = node
.caret_color
.or(theme.caret.color)
.and_then(Color::to_rgb);
}
Some(if node.vim_motions && caret_shape == CaretShape::Block {
match text_area_vim_state
.get(&id)
.map(|state| state.mode)
.unwrap_or_default()
{
TextAreaVimMode::Insert => CaretShape::Bar,
TextAreaVimMode::Normal
| TextAreaVimMode::Visual
| TextAreaVimMode::VisualLine => CaretShape::Block,
}
} else {
caret_shape
})
}
}
NodeKind::Input(node) => {
if node.read_only {
None
} else {
if self.osc12_supported {
desired_cursor_color = node
.caret_color
.or(theme.caret.color)
.and_then(Color::to_rgb);
}
Some(node.caret_shape.unwrap_or(theme.caret.shape))
}
}
#[cfg(feature = "terminal")]
NodeKind::Terminal(node) => {
if self.osc12_supported {
desired_cursor_color = node.caret_color.and_then(Color::to_rgb);
}
if node.cursor_visible {
Some(node.cursor_shape)
} else {
None
}
}
_ => None,
};
if let Some(caret_shape) = caret {
match caret_shape {
CaretShape::Bar => target_style = SetCursorStyle::SteadyBar,
CaretShape::Block => target_style = SetCursorStyle::SteadyBlock,
CaretShape::Underline => target_style = SetCursorStyle::SteadyUnderScore,
}
}
}
if desired_cursor_color != self.last_cursor_color {
if let Some((r, g, b)) = desired_cursor_color {
execute!(
backend,
Print(format!("\x1b]12;#{r:02x}{g:02x}{b:02x}\x07"))
)?;
} else if self.last_cursor_color.is_some() {
execute!(backend, Print("\x1b]112\x07"))?;
}
self.last_cursor_color = desired_cursor_color;
}
execute!(backend, target_style)?;
Ok(())
}
pub fn reset_cursor<B: std::io::Write>(&mut self, backend: &mut B) -> Result<()> {
if self.last_cursor_color.is_some() {
execute!(backend, Print("\x1b]112\x07"))?;
self.last_cursor_color = None;
}
Ok(())
}
}
fn supports_osc12_cursor_color() -> bool {
if let Ok(value) = std::env::var("TUI_LIPAN_OSC12") {
let value = value.trim().to_ascii_lowercase();
if matches!(value.as_str(), "0" | "false" | "off" | "no") {
return false;
}
if matches!(value.as_str(), "1" | "true" | "on" | "yes") {
return true;
}
}
true
}
